More

From NET Wiki
Jump to navigation Jump to search

You may want to organize a party on weekends, but you do not want to call every friend of yours. This mobile social application helps you broadcast this party event to anyone you want to invite via WiFi/Bluetooth/SMS. The people who receive the message can confirm if they will come to the party or not. It also share information (i.e., pictures, music) within a group that owns same interest. People may also want to search a piece of information or a contact from a group of people, after providing enough information, the message can broadcast to a certain group of people. People who has the piece of information or the contact can send back to you.

The current prototype supports microblogging and broadcasting. In this project, you needs to complete the following functions:

1. Add WiFi function to Goose

The current Goose can only use Bluetooth and SMS for message transmission. As the first part of the project, we want to extend the Goose to support WiFi as well.

2. File transmission and contact import

Develop the Goose to make it support file transmission, including pictures, mp3 music files and etc. You also need to expand Goose to import contact information from his phone's contact list.

3. Add group function to Goose

Make Goose support group function, which means a Goose user can organize a group and all group members can share information within the group.

Requirements:

1. Profficiency with Java programming

2. Must attend the weekly meeting, which may happens in the afternoon or weekends. We can negotiate the meeting time later.


If you are interested in this project, please contact me via zhu at cs dot uni-goettingen dot de.